The Social Creative Director will lead the creative vision for Spotify's global social presence, ensuring every piece of content is visually compelling, culturally relevant, and unmistakably Spotify. Working across Brand, Product, Music, Podcasts, Audiobooks, and Fitness, you'll help shape how millions of fans experience Spotify every day through innovative storytelling and world-class creative.

As a creative leader, you'll inspire and develop a high-performing team while partnering closely with cross-functional stakeholders to deliver work that pushes creative boundaries and strengthens Spotify's position as a leader in social storytelling.

What You'll Do

  • Lead the creative vision for Spotify's global social channels, delivering innovative, high-quality storytelling that strengthens the brand across Brand, Product, Music, Podcasts, Audiobooks, and Fitness.
  • Partner with cross-functional teams (including Social Strategy, Brand, Project Management, and agency partners) to develop and deliver social-first campaigns from concept through execution.
  • Lead, mentor, and inspire a team of creatives, fostering a collaborative, inclusive environment and ensuring creative excellence across every project.
  • Champion consistency by maintaining Spotify's social brand guidelines, developing scalable creative toolkits, and partnering with regional teams to deliver a cohesive global social presence.
  • Stay ahead of emerging social trends, platform capabilities, and audience behaviors, while confidently presenting creative work and recommendations to senior leadership.

Who You Are

  • You have at least 10+ years of creative leadership experience in entertainment, technology, media, or consumer brands, with a strong portfolio of social-first work.
  • You have deep expertise in social platforms, content formats, and creative best practices, and know how to turn strategy into engaging, culturally relevant storytelling.
  • You are an experienced people leader who builds strong partnerships, communicates with influence, and th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.
  • You care deeply about creative quality, bring a solutions-oriented mindset, and inspire teams to produce work that pushes creative boundaries while delivering meaningful business impact.

Where You'll Be

  • This role can be based in New York or Los Angeles.
  • We offer you the flexibility to work where you work best! There will be some in person meetings, but still allows for flexibility to work from home.
  • We ask that you come in 1-2 times per week.

The United States base range for this position is $162,432- $232,047, plus equity (plus bonus or commission. The benefits available for this position include health insurance, six month paid parental leave, 401(k) retirement plan, 23 paid days off, 13 paid flexible holidays.
